Description

1-Isoquinolineethanol,1,2,3,4-Tetrahydro-6,7-Dimethoxy- is a high-purity, synthetically versatile isoquinoline derivative of significant interest in advanced organic synthesis. This compound serves as a critical chiral building block and synthetic intermediate for the development of complex, biologically active molecules. It is primarily sought after by research institutions and pharmaceutical companies engaged in the development of new therapeutic agents and fine chemical processes.

Basic Information

Product Name 1-Isoquinolineethanol,1,2,3,4-Tetrahydro-6,7-Dimethoxy-
CAS No. 51452-46-1
Molecular Formula C₁₃H₁₉NO₃
Molecular Weight 237.29 g/mol
Synonyms 6,7-Dimethoxy-1,2,3,4-tetrahydro-1-isoquinolineethanol; (1,2,3,4-Tetrahydro-6,7-dimethoxy-1-isoquinolinyl)methanol; 1-(Hydroxymethyl)-6,7-dimethoxy-1,2,3,4-tetrahydroisoquinoline; 6,7-Dimethoxy-1,2,3,4-tetrahydroisoquinoline-1-methanol; THIQ derivative

Storage

Preserve in a tightly closed container, protected from light. Store in a cool, dry, well-ventilated area at controlled room temperature (15-25°C). Keep away from strong oxidizing agents.
